AI Summary

  • Establishes the Palliative Care Information and Education Program within the Virginia Department of Health to provide information and resources about palliative care to health care providers, patients, and families

  • Creates the Palliative Care and Quality of Life Advisory Council to advise the Department of Health on matters related to palliative care education, access, and quality improvement

  • Requires all hospitals, nursing homes, and certified nursing facilities to establish systems for identifying patients who may benefit from palliative care and to facilitate access to appropriate services

  • Applies to patients experiencing conditions that substantially affect quality of life for extended periods, including cancer, heart failure, renal failure, liver failure, chronic spinal injury, traumatic brain injury, lung disease, ALS, and Alzheimer's disease

  • Directs the Board of Health to develop regulations in consultation with the Advisory Council, considering factors such as facility size, geographic location, and proximity to palliative care services including hospice and board-certified providers
